Ecore_Evas (wayland): Do not set the shell_surface_listeners until
authorChristopher Michael <cpmichael1@comcast.net>
Fri, 13 Jan 2012 00:01:09 +0000 (00:01 +0000)
committerChristopher Michael <cpmichael1@comcast.net>
Fri, 13 Jan 2012 00:01:09 +0000 (00:01 +0000)
commitce12a4481bfdb83f680ff75b500e50126438760b
tree02453ebc246975667d7975535987495db10ee031
parent1a34b86f34221cc1511401be4ebfd6eea840e394
Ecore_Evas (wayland): Do not set the shell_surface_listeners until
After we have set the new surface for the evas engine. Reason being:
The shell_surface_listener_configure event handles resizing the
ecore_evas. If that gets called Before we have set the new engine
surface, then bad crashes can happen.

SVN revision: 67161
legacy/ecore/src/lib/ecore_evas/ecore_evas_wayland_egl.c
legacy/ecore/src/lib/ecore_evas/ecore_evas_wayland_shm.c